About Badiyaraysal

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Badiyaraysal village is 473492. Badiyaraysal village is located in Sonkatch tehsil of Dewas district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Sonkatch (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Dewas. As per 2009 stats, Chandakhedi is the gram panchayat of Badiyaraysal village.

The total geographical area of village is 124.53 hectares. Badiyaraysal has a total population of 212 peoples, out of which male population is 111 while female population is 101. Literacy rate of badiyaraysal village is 49.53% out of which 65.77% males and 31.68% females are literate. There are about 45 houses in badiyaraysal village.

Sonkatch is nearest town to badiyaraysal for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.
